After reinstalling Windows 11, I'm seeing two of my disks showing up in the left sidebar of File Explorer, but I can't find them listed under 'This PC.' I'd like to know how I can remove these extra disk entries.
2 Answers
You could also check the registry to fix this issue. Navigate to `H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INESOFTWAREMicrosoftWindowsCurrentVersionExplorerDesktopNameSpace` and look for any double entries you might want to remove. Just be cautious when editing the registry, as it can affect your system.
It sounds like you might be seeing some leftover entries from your previous installation or from external tools. You can tweak your Folder Options to manage how drives are displayed. Go to View > Options in File Explorer, from there you can adjust the settings to hide or show drives under ‘This PC’. Also, you could check your registry settings if you're comfortable doing that.
